🎓 دوره آموزشی جامع
📚 اطلاعات دوره
عنوان دوره: مقدمهای بر محاسبات موازی: طراحی، تحلیل و پیادهسازی
موضوع کلی: محاسبات پیشرفته و موازی
موضوع میانی: اصول و مبانی برنامهنویسی موازی
📋 سرفصلهای دوره (100 موضوع)
- 1. مقدمهای بر دنیای محاسبات موازی
- 2. چرا به محاسبات موازی نیاز داریم؟
- 3. رشد محدودیتهای قانون مور
- 4. نیازهای برنامههای امروزی
- 5. انواع معماریهای کامپیوتری
- 6. ساختارهای کامپیوتری سنتی
- 7. موازیسازی در سطح دستورالعمل (ILP)
- 8. معماریهای چند هستهای (Multi-core)
- 9. معماریهای پردازندههای گرافیکی (GPU)
- 10. رایانش خوشهای (Cluster Computing)
- 11. رایانش ابری (Cloud Computing)
- 12. شبکههای کامپیوتری
- 13. مبانی انتقال داده در شبکههای موازی
- 14. پروتکلهای ارتباطی
- 15. کارایی شبکه
- 16. مفاهیم اساسی در برنامهنویسی موازی
- 17. واحد کار (Work Unit)
- 18. داده موازی (Data Parallelism)
- 19. وظیفه موازی (Task Parallelism)
- 20. وابستگی داده (Data Dependency)
- 21. مسابقه (Race Condition)
- 22. بنبست (Deadlock)
- 23. قفل (Lock)
- 24. همگامسازی (Synchronization)
- 25. مدلهای برنامهنویسی موازی
- 26. مدل پیامرسان (Message Passing Model)
- 27. مدل حافظه مشترک (Shared Memory Model)
- 28. مدل توزیع شده (Distributed Memory Model)
- 29. ترکیب مدلها
- 30. مفهوم موازیسازی
- 31. انواع موازیسازی
- 32. موازیسازی داده
- 33. موازیسازی وظیفه
- 34. موازات (Concurrency) و موازیسازی (Parallelism)
- 35. تفاوتهای کلیدی
- 36. مشکلات رایج در طراحی برنامههای موازی
- 37. برنامهنویسی در محیط حافظه مشترک
- 38. مفاهیم پلتفرمهای حافظه مشترک
- 39. موضوعات (Threads)
- 40. ایجاد و مدیریت موضوعات
- 41. هماهنگسازی موضوعات
- 42. مسائل همگامسازی
- 43. قفلهای انحصاری (Mutex Locks)
- 44. اجرای اتمی (Atomic Operations)
- 45. semafors
- 46. conditions variables
- 47. Barrier Synchronization
- 48. مسائل مشترک در حافظه مشترک
- 49. موازیسازی با OpenMP
- 50. آشنایی با OpenMP
- 51. دستورالعملهای OpenMP
- 52. دستورالعمل موازیسازی {#pragma omp parallel}
- 53. دستورالعملهای وظیفه {#pragma omp task}
- 54. دستورالعملهای حلقه {#pragma omp for}
- 55. دستورالعملهای بخش بحرانی {#pragma omp critical}
- 56. دستورالعملهای atomic {#pragma omp atomic}
- 57. دستورالعملهای reduction {#pragma omp reduction}
- 58. راهنمای استفاده عملی از OpenMP
- 59. مثالهای عملی با OpenMP
- 60. برنامهنویسی در محیط پیامرسان
- 61. مفهوم پیامرسانی
- 62. پروتکل MPI (Message Passing Interface)
- 63. نصب و راهاندازی MPI
- 64. توابع اولیه MPI
- 65. ارسال و دریافت پیام (Send/Recv)
- 66. توابع ارتباطی گروهی (Collective Communication)
- 67. Broadcast
- 68. Gather
- 69. Scatter
- 70. Reduce
- 71. Allreduce
- 72. Parallel I/O با MPI
- 73. مفاهیم پیشرفته MPI
- 74. MPI Topologies
- 75. MPI Datatypes
- 76. MPI Communicators
- 77. راهنمای عملی MPI
- 78. مثالهای عملی با MPI
- 79. پردازش موازی بر روی GPU
- 80. مقدمهای بر معماری GPU
- 81. مدل برنامهنویسی CUDA
- 82. مفاهیم اصلی CUDA
- 83. Kernel Launch
- 84. Thread Hierarchy
- 85. Grid, Block, Thread
- 86. Memory Hierarchy in CUDA
- 87. Global Memory
- 88. Shared Memory
- 89. Local Memory
- 90. Constant Memory
- 91. Texture Memory
- 92. مدیریت حافظه در CUDA
- 93. انتقال داده بین CPU و GPU
- 94. بهینهسازی برنامههای CUDA
- 95. Parallel Programming Patterns
- 96. Data Parallelism Patterns
- 97. Task Parallelism Patterns
- 98. Divide and Conquer Patterns
- 99. Pipeline Patterns
- 100. MapReduce Pattern
آیا برای جهش در دنیای محاسبات پیشرفته آمادهاید؟
در دنیای امروز، حجم دادهها روز به روز در حال افزایش است و نیاز به سرعت پردازش بالاتر از همیشه احساس میشود. الگوریتمهای سنتی دیگر پاسخگوی این حجم عظیم از دادهها نیستند. راه حل چیست؟ محاسبات موازی!
دوره آموزشی “مقدمهای بر محاسبات موازی: طراحی، تحلیل و پیادهسازی” به شما کمک میکند تا با قدرت محاسبات موازی آشنا شوید و توانایی حل مسائل پیچیده را در کمترین زمان ممکن کسب کنید. این دوره با الهام از کتاب ارزشمند “Introduction to Parallel Computing” طراحی شده است و مفاهیم کلیدی را به زبانی ساده و کاربردی ارائه میدهد.
درباره دوره
این دوره جامع، شما را از سطح مبتدی تا پیشرفته در دنیای محاسبات موازی همراهی میکند. ما اصول و مبانی برنامهنویسی موازی را به طور کامل پوشش میدهیم و به شما نشان میدهیم چگونه الگوریتمهای خود را برای اجرا بر روی معماریهای موازی مختلف طراحی و پیادهسازی کنید. با تکیه بر مفاهیم ارائه شده در کتاب “Introduction to Parallel Computing”، این دوره به شما دانش و مهارتهای لازم برای مواجهه با چالشهای دنیای محاسبات را میدهد.
موضوعات کلیدی دوره
- مقدمهای بر محاسبات موازی و معماریهای موازی
- مدلهای برنامهنویسی موازی (Thread-based, Message-passing)
- الگوریتمهای موازی برای مسائل مختلف (مرتبسازی، جستجو، جبر خطی)
- تحلیل عملکرد الگوریتمهای موازی
- بهینهسازی کد برای معماریهای موازی
- برنامهنویسی با MPI و OpenMP
- اشکالزدایی و پروفایلینگ برنامههای موازی
- محاسبات موازی روی GPU
- کاربردهای محاسبات موازی در علوم مختلف (هوش مصنوعی، دادهکاوی، …)
مخاطبان دوره
این دوره برای طیف وسیعی از افراد مناسب است، از جمله:
- دانشجویان رشتههای مهندسی کامپیوتر، علوم کامپیوتر و سایر رشتههای مرتبط
- برنامهنویسانی که به دنبال افزایش سرعت و کارایی برنامههای خود هستند
- محققانی که با حجم زیادی از دادهها سروکار دارند
- افرادی که به یادگیری تکنولوژیهای جدید و پیشرفته علاقهمند هستند
چرا این دوره را بگذرانیم؟
با گذراندن این دوره، شما:
- دانش عمیقی در زمینه محاسبات موازی کسب خواهید کرد.
- توانایی طراحی و پیادهسازی الگوریتمهای موازی را به دست خواهید آورد.
- میتوانید سرعت پردازش برنامههای خود را به طور چشمگیری افزایش دهید.
- مهارتهای لازم برای کار با تکنولوژیهای پیشرفته را کسب خواهید کرد.
- فرصتهای شغلی جدیدی در زمینههای مختلف برای شما ایجاد خواهد شد.
- از رقبا پیشی خواهید گرفت و در دنیای پرشتاب فناوری امروز، یک گام جلوتر خواهید بود.
- مسائل پیچیده را به روشی کارآمدتر و سریعتر حل خواهید کرد.
- بهرهوری و کارایی خود را در انجام پروژههای مختلف افزایش خواهید داد.
- با مفاهیم ارائه شده در کتاب “Introduction to Parallel Computing” به صورت عملی آشنا خواهید شد.
سرفصلهای دوره (100 سرفصل جامع)
دوره شامل 100 سرفصل جامع و کاربردی است که به صورت گام به گام شما را در دنیای محاسبات موازی راهنمایی میکند. به دلیل حجم زیاد، فهرست کامل سرفصلها در اینجا آورده نشده است، اما میتوانید با کلیک بر روی دکمه زیر، لیست کامل سرفصلها را مشاهده کنید:
همین امروز در دوره “مقدمهای بر محاسبات موازی: طراحی، تحلیل و پیادهسازی” ثبتنام کنید و آینده شغلی خود را متحول سازید!
📚 محتوای این محصول آموزشی (پکیج کامل)
💡 این محصول یک نسخهٔ کامل و جامع است
تمامی محتوای آموزشی این کتاب در قالب یک بستهی کامل و یکپارچه ارائه میشود و شامل تمام نسخهها و فایلهای موردنیاز برای یادگیری است.
🎁 محتویات کامل بسته دانلودی
- ویدیوهای آموزشی فارسی — آموزش قدمبهقدم، کاربردی و قابل فهم
- پادکستهای صوتی فارسی — توضیح مفاهیم کلیدی و نکات تکمیلی
- کتاب PDF فارسی — شامل کلیهٔ سرفصلها و محتوای آموزشی
- کتاب خلاصه نکات ویدیوها و پادکستها – نسخه PDF — مناسب مرور سریع و جمعبندی مباحث
- کتاب صدها نکته فارسی (خودمونی) – نسخه PDF — زبان ساده و کاربردی
- کتاب صدها نکته رسمی فارسی – نسخه PDF — نگارش استاندارد، علمی و مناسب چاپ
-
کتاب صدها پرسش و پاسخ تشریحی – نسخه PDF
— هر سؤال بلافاصله همراه با پاسخ کامل و شفاف ارائه شده است؛ مناسب درک عمیق مفاهیم و رفع ابهام. -
کتاب صدها پرسش و پاسخ چهارگزینهای – نسخه PDF (نسخه یادگیری سریع)
— پاسخها بلافاصله پس از سؤال قرار دارند؛ مناسب یادگیری سریع و تثبیت مطالب. -
کتاب صدها پرسش و پاسخ چهارگزینهای – نسخه PDF (نسخه خودآزمایی پایانبخش)
— پاسخها در انتهای هر بخش آمدهاند؛ مناسب آزمون واقعی و سنجش میزان یادگیری. -
کتاب تمرینهای درست / نادرست (True / False) – نسخه PDF
— مناسب افزایش دقت مفهومی و تشخیص صحیح یا نادرست بودن گزارهها. -
کتاب تمرینهای جای خالی – نسخه PDF
— تقویت یادگیری فعال و تسلط بر مفاهیم و اصطلاحات کلیدی.
🎯 این بسته یک دورهٔ آموزشی کامل و چندلایه است؛ شامل آموزش تصویری، صوتی، کتابها، تمرینها و خودآزمایی .
ℹ️ نکات مهم هنگام خرید
- این محصول به صورت فایل دانلودی کامل ارائه میشود و نسخهٔ چاپی ندارد.
- تمامی فایلها و کتابها کاملاً فارسی هستند.
- توجه: لینکهای اختصاصی دوره طی ۴۸ ساعت پس از ثبت سفارش ارسال میشوند.
- نیازی به درج شماره موبایل نیست؛ اما برای پشتیبانی سریعتر توصیه میشود.
- در صورت بروز مشکل در دانلود با شماره 09395106248 تماس بگیرید.
- اگر پرداخت انجام شده ولی لینکها را دریافت نکردهاید، نام و نام خانوادگی و نام محصول را پیامک کنید تا لینکها دوباره ارسال شوند.
💬 راههای ارتباطی پشتیبانی:
واتساپ یا پیامک:
09395106248
تلگرام: @ma_limbs



نقد و بررسیها
هنوز بررسیای ثبت نشده است.